1
Sit upright on the machine seat with feet flat on the floor or footrest. Grasp the cable handles with arms extended overhead, maintaining neutral spine alignment and core engagement.
2
Position hands slightly wider than shoulder-width with a pronated grip (palms facing down). Ensure shoulder blades are retracted and chest is upright before initiating the pull.
3
Slowly lower the cable handles overhead by extending the arms upward and backward in a controlled manner, allowing the shoulder joint to flex fully while maintaining core stability and avoiding excessive lower back extension.
4
Pull the cable handles down toward the torso by driving elbows down and back, retracting the shoulder blades and flexing the lats. Return to the starting position with arms extended overhead, maintaining constant tension on the latissimus dorsi throughout the movement.
